Deciphering Wagering Requirements & Limits in F7 and Basswin Bonuses

Wagering requirements, often exp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ount (e.g., 30x), determine how many times players must wager the bonus before withdrawal eligibility. F7’s bonuses generally feature more favorable terms, such as 25-30x wagering within 24-48 hours, catering to high rollers who prefer quick turnarounds. Basswin’s bonuses might impose higher requirements, such as 40-50x, with longer expiry periods of up to 7 days, suitable for casual players who wager less frequently.
